> Adds the demuxer of animated WebP files.
> It supports non-animated, animated, truncated, and concatenated
> files.
> Reading from a pipe (and other non-seekable inputs) is also
> supported.
> 
> The WebP demuxer splits the input stream into packets containing one
> frame.
> It also marks the key frames properly.
> The loop count is ignored by default (same behaviour as animated PNG
> and GIF),
> it may be enabled by the option '-ignore_loop 0'.

Should format duration not also be set accordingly? I don't see
anything setting it at all, only packet duration
